So I might not be totally objective, but I do try. This is a very high speed blender, with a whopping 64 ox pitcher, and a 21 oz "to-go-cup". I have tried it out for several days now, even using it for foods I don't normally make, just to see how it handled. Impressed is an understatement. 1) The manual is excellent. Although this is a foreign company (the blender is made in China) you could not tell it by the quality of both the English, and the writing of the manual. It is complete. It covers everything you need to know. It has a troubleshooting section. In short, the kind of manual we are used to here in the US, and that instantly gives me confidence in operation, clean up, and figuring out the occasional problem.. (It also discusses motor overheating, and how to avoid it; or if, you didn't read that part, how long to wait to continue.) 2) The warranty is very nice: 2 years. And the customer service contact information is prominent. 3) Cleaning: this is rather unique; unlike other blenders, you do NOT disassemble the lower section which contains the blades, etc. You clean the unit on the base, using a small amount of detergent with water, and running the machine. I like that, because the blades are very sharp, and this method not only works, but it eliminates the potential for accidents and damage to the blades. Well thought out design. 4) The instructions are beautifully clear; they give you the average size of the fruit you are to use; the instructions on measuring liquids with the cap; how to use the tamper; and what each speed will do. They also give you the automatic shut off times. 5) The easiest for last: how does it work? Wow. I have had blenders most of my adult life; we all know how they can be great, but also frustrating; but this blender simply performs, and does it beautifully. I was unable to find anything that "stumped it", and although yes, I needed to use the tamper on occasion, at least they gave me a tamper to work with. In short, I recommend this highly.
